Understanding the Arlington Library Passport Program

The core of the Arlington Library Passport is a lending system similar to checking out a book, but for experiences. Patrons can reserve passes online or at the circulation desk, allowing them entry to a curated list of partner institutions. These passes typically accommodate varying group sizes and validity periods, ensuring flexibility for different family needs and itineraries. The program is designed to make leisure and learning accessible, turning spontaneous "let's go out" plans into reality with just a library card.

How to Access and Use Your Passport

Securing a pass is straightforward, leveraging the library's existing digital infrastructure. Users log into the library catalog with their account credentials, navigate to the passes section, and select their desired destination. Reservations typically require a library card in good standing and may include a limit on the number of passes checked out per month. Upon arrival at the venue, the pass is presented for admission, often in place of standard ticket pricing.
